Job Description

Essential Functions

  • Manage a team of meeting planners including office-based/ home-based/hybrid employees.
  • Drive optimal employee performance of direct reports through effective coaching and performance management with a focus on promoting employee engagement, a positive work environment, and efficient delivery of results.
  • Set comprehensive and measurable goals for maximum team and individual performance, which includes a balanced focus on productivity, quality, effective communication, and overall customer service.
  • Ensure client defined business rules are applied by team throughout the planning lifecycle of the programs to ensure compliance and customer experience expectations are met.
  • Manage daily task and SLA deadlines across client portfolio, with proactive identification of potential outliers and prompt enactment of mitigation plans as necessary to protect SLAs and customer experience.
  • Proactively raise any critical-to-compliance concerns
  • Plan and manage resources to meet forecasted workload; monitor workload and key performance indicators to prioritize and rebalance resources when appropriate.
  • Be a proactive, engaged, and collaborative member of the client Core Team to partner with Customer Success and Product Support on client SOW deliverables, profitability, and retention.
  • Primary point of contact for all customer service inquiries, research, and formal incident response to include identification of root cause and implementation of corrective and preventative actions.
  • Owner of client SOP maintenance and setup of client business rule within planning platform
  • Responsible to triage issues between primary technology platforms and escalate to support teams as necessary for resolution.


Qualifications:

  • 5+ years of meeting industry experience
  • Previous experience with leading people, managing teams, or leading projects is highly desirable.
  • Life Sciences experience preferred, working knowledge of HCP interaction regulations a plus.
  • Bachelor's Degree is preferred.
  • Demonstrated resourcefulness in setting priorities, reprioritizing as business/client needs shift, and providing solutions-oriented response.
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ills with focus on the ability to be concise and clear, summarize a situation and articulate the necessary next steps, effectively listen, and assess the need for urgent action.
  • Competency to effectively communicate a message to resonate with various audiences such as frontline employees, external clients, and technology support.
  • Ability to analyze data and meeting detail information, understand the story it tells and articulate the action required in a consumable manner.
  • Strong sense of urgency and the ability to effectively problem solve.
  • Ability to identify and create solutions that are equally focused on efficiency and the customer experience.
  • Passion to lead individuals and teams to achieve agreed upon goals, deliver measurable results, navigate obstacles, embrace, change, and celebrate success.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office suite of products (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Teams) and Outlook required.
  • Knowledge in SharePoint, Salesforce, Zoom and Smartsheet preferred.

About IQVIA

IQVIA (NYSE:IQV) is a leading global provider of clinical research services, commercial insights and healthcare intelligence to the life sciences and healthcare industries. IQVIA’s portfolio of solutions are powered by IQVIA Connected Intelligence™ to deliver actionable insights and services built on high-quality health data, Healthcare-grade AI™, advanced analytics, the latest technologies and extensive domain expertise. With approximately 88,000 employees in over 100 countries, including experts in healthcare, life sciences, data science, technology and operational excellence, IQVIA is dedicated to accelerating the development and commercialization of innovative medical treatments to help improve patient outcomes and population health worldwide.

IQVIA is a global leader in protecting individual patient privacy. The company uses a wide variety of privacy-enhancing technologies and safeguards to protect individual privacy while generating and analyzing information on a scale that helps healthcare stakeholders identify disease patterns and correlate with the precise treatment path and therapy needed for better outcomes. IQVIA’s insights and execution capabilities help biotech, medical device and pharmaceutical companies, medical researchers, government agencies, payers and other healthcare stakeholders tap into a deeper understanding of diseases, human behaviors and scientific progress, in an effort to advance healthcare.
